

Luther Davis Evans, 95, of Dunedin, passed away on September 16, 2024. He was born in New York City, New York to Luther and Myra Evans on November 7, 1928. Luther enlisted in the United States Marine Corp at the age of 17 and served from 1945-1948 being awarded the Good Conduct Medal and the WWII Victory Medal. After he served, he returned home to complete his High School Education in 1950. Luther met Joan Bazemore as part of the youth group at Broadway Temple Methodist Church where they married on May 26, 1951. Luther had a career in law enforcement serving as a patrolman and detective for 20 years with the NYPD. After retiring in 1972, he moved with his family to Florida.
Luther was a natural athlete and enjoyed many sports over the years – skiing, diving, swimming, boxing, football, racquetball and most recently cycling. He played football for the USMC in the China Bowl in 1948. He was an avid cyclist and loved to be outdoors.
Another passion of Luther’s was studying God’s word with his friends at the Community Men’s Bible Study where his faith in Christ blossomed. He attended Clearwater Community Church with his family for more than 20 years. His family brought him much joy, and he enjoyed spending time with them.
